BIA Publishes Proposed Changes to Self-Determination Regulations

Media Contact: Lovett 343-7445
For Immediate Release: March 31, 1978

The Bureau of Indian Affairs announced today that proposed revisions in the regulations governing contracts and grants under the Indian Self-Determination and Education Assistance Act (P.L. 93-638) were published in the Federal Register March 28.

The Self-Determination Act regulations require that the Bureau annually consult with Indian tribes and organizations about the need to revise the regulations. These proposed changes are the result of the consultation with Indian tribes and organizations.

Probably the most significant change being proposed is the addition of procedures to deal with the situation in which a contract proposal is adequate but the Bureau does not have sufficient funds to fund it. Comments on the proposed regulations should be sent within 30 days of publication to the Bureau of Indian Affairs Code l06t 18th and C Street N.W. Washington D.C. 20245
